What A Rig Actually Is

A rig isn't a machine. It's a payroll.

Every rig that stands up needs drillers, derrick hands, motormen, floorhands. Then comes everything behind it...dirt work, water, gravel, hotshot loads, wireline, cement, frac crews, workover rig hand, pipeline hands.

54 new rigs in a year isn't a statistic. It's thousands of paychecks that didn't exist last August.

The Catch

Texas and New Mexico are eating first. Texas is sitting at 277 rigs and New Mexico added 3 more last week alone.

The Bakken is holding at 24...steady, not surging. Yet. North Dakota crude spent this spring selling at a premium over West Texas barrels for the first time since the 80s. Money like that doesn't stay ignored forever.
